| 1 | SH-I: VRV/ VRF Work (BOQ Item No:- 01 to 10)Supplying, Installation, Testing & Commissioning of Modular type Variable Refrigerant Flow/Variable Refrigerant Volume air cooled Outdoor units suitable for cooling/heating having 100% hermetically sealed inverter type twin Rotary/Scroll Compressor(s), minimum two compressors (with individual separate PCB) for above 6 HP modules, microprocessor based Controller, top discharge type condensing unit(s), with R-410-A Refrigerant or equivalent, vibration Isolators with suitable foundation etc. complete as required. To have better efficiency condensor fan shall be capable to operate at different speed with respect to load.The unit shall deliver the rated capacity and in confirmation as per IS 18728:2024 and CPWD Specifications and work even at 50°C ambient temperature without tripping. The system shall be able to deliver 100% of the rated capacity upto 39 °C. The unit shall be suitable to work on 400V +/- 10%, 3 Phase, 50Hz AC power supply and BMS compatible. The unit shall be filled with first charge of the refrigerant and ready for use as required. The condenser should be coated with a hydrophilic film to prevent water accumulation on the surface of the heat exchanger, enhance water dispersion, and reduce the risk of degradation, thereby improving overall performance and durability. The Indian Seasonal Energy Efficiency Ratio (ISEER) of the unit shall be as per Energy Conservation and Sustainable Building Code (ECSBC) 2024 as below and complete as per CPWD specification, connections, inter connections etc. as required. (For capacity <40 kWr ISEER 7.4, Capacity > 40 and <70 ISEER 7.5, Capacity > 70 ISEER 7.6 for super ECSBC Building) For Cooling or Heating or Both.The VRV/VRF unit should be an higher energy-efficient model compliant with BEE regulations. The unit should have free phase technology / Phase loss / Missing phase so that unit can work in case of phase reversal and PCB protection low and high voltage support. compressor operate together as one logical unit, sharing refrigerant load, control signals, Allows continued operation (If one compressor fails continuosly running remaining compressor, like as master and slave configuration). Including all the dip switches and/or control wiring as per OEM recommendation.Refrigerant suction/Liquid line tapping including Pressure testing, vaccummissing of the VRV/VRF system complete as per specifications etc. as required. The outdoor unit shall be installed on Soft Soil at Gronnd Level i/c providing anti-vibration mounting. The PCC base is excluded from this scope. |

| 4 | Indoor UnitSupplying, Installation, Testing and Commissioning of following minimum capacity 4 way Cassette Type Indoor ceiling mounted unit equipped with synthetic washable media pre-filter, fan section with low noise fan/dynamically balanced blower, multispeed motor, coil section with DX Copper coil, electronic expansion valve, outer cabinet, drain pump, grill, necessary supports, vibration Isolation etc., suitable for operation on single phase 230 V ± 10%, 50Hz AC supply, complete, as required. The Indoor units must shut down upon receiving a singal from the BMS System/Fire Singnals. The system shall be capable to adjust air flow as per room requirement in auto mode. The cooling capacity of indoor unit will be at air inlet conditions of 27 °C DB and 19 °C WB temperature. (Make will be same as of Outdoor)Indoor Unit:- 4.0 TR to 4.2 TRNote:- The cutting / fixing of existing false ceiling for fixing of cassette IDUs and making good the same, all labour, packing materials, tools, scaffolding, and disposal of debris is included in the scope. |
| 5 | Indoor UnitSupplying, Installation, Testing and Commissioning of following minimum capacity and external static pressure VRF/VRV ceiling mounted mid high static ductable type Indoor unit equipped with washable synthetic media prefilter, fan section with low noise fan/dynamically balanced blower, multispeed motor, coil section with DX copper coil, electronic expansion valve, Cordless Remote, outer cabinet, vibration Isolators, drain pan, drain pump, other necessary supports etc., suitable for operation on single phase AC supply 230 V ± 10%, 50 Hz complete as required. The Indoor units must shut down upon receiving a singal from the BMS System/Fire Singnals. The system shall be capable to adjust air flow as per room requirement automatically. The cooling capacity of indoor unit will be at air inlet conditions of 27 0C DB and 19 0C WB temperature. (Make will be same as of Outdoor) High Static Ductable units (minimum 49 to 77 pascal external static pressure) - 4.0 TR to 4.2 TRNote:- The High Static Ductable units needs to be hanged from the existing false ceiling through MS rods / hanger alongwith MS frames as per stie requirement complete in all aspect. Minor cutting / modification in existing false ceiling required for fixing of suspended ductable units and making good the same, all labour, packing materials, tools, scaffolding, and disposal of debris is included in the scope. |

| 10 | COPPER REFRIGERANT PIPINGSupplying, Installation, testing and commissioning including vaccumiazation and Nitrogen testing of following nominal sizes of soft/hard drawn copper refrigerant piping for VRV/VRF system, complete with fittings, with suitable adjustable ring type hanger supports, jointing/brazing including accessories, insulated with XPLE Class-O tubular insulation/with Class-O closed cell elastometric nitrile rubber tubular sleeves sections of 19 mm thick insulation as given below for Suction and Liquid lines, all accessories as per specifications etc. as required :Copper Pipe laying each indoor unit to outdoor unit should be properly and covered arrangements from outdoor to indoor unit to be made in open area as per site requirement. Additionally, the copper pipes must be wrapped with fiberglass insulation tape and coated with UV-resistant paint. The size of refrigerant pipes shown below are tentative. The required size of pipe shall be designed by the vendor as per the manufacturers recommendations. |
